Competitive Moat

HPE operates mission-critical IT infrastructure, storage, and networking solutions for large enterprises, with a defensible position in hybrid cloud and edge computing via proprietary software-defined platforms and deep enterprise relationships. Its GreenLake platform integrates AI-driven management and analytics, creating sticky, recurring revenue streams that are hard for competitors to displace.
